Setting an alarm is a basic watch function. I was so disappointed to give up my trusty old ironman watch to find that I still needed a phone I set an alarm. If the Blaze has a stopwatch and timer, why can it not set (and label) alarms on its own? It makes the alarm setting pointless and disappointing
Ability to add alarms on the fit bit blaze itself without going into the app. If you can set the time for the countdown timer, then it should be an easy add to get the same function on the alarms part of the watch.
I'm glad to announce that this is a feature in the Fitbit Blaze. You can now set an alarm directly from the tracker, you can learn more about how to start using this feature by checking this article How do I manage silent alarms?.
